Output 8bd57ab63b26fa27d28a2f9b1a83e642624219a2e14d178272b13cf8ad35e875:1

value
12113593866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 963b38d36db2a1d6ada1cde4273583efea9cb2e9 OP_EQUAL
address
MMbWY26q72zdCsu1w6CYZj2Ag1aEnFJS5M
transaction
8bd57ab63b26fa27d28a2f9b1a83e642624219a2e14d178272b13cf8ad35e875
spent
true